Presently PPP offers no source of phosphorite, granted there's a huge amount of existing phosphorite on a PPP map, and it doesn't have particularly critical uses, with the main three being Wheezewort, Pincha Peppernuts and Fertilizer, additionally Shine Bugs though they aren't native to PPP maps. You can probably go thousands of cycles without running out.

But it would be nice to have a Phosphorite source without needing Dreckos or Bammoths, both of which somewhat undermine Rhexes.

My suggestion would be to turn Gnits into a source of Phosphorite, either dropping a little when they die like Beetas drop a little nuclear waste, or processing the eggs into a little phosphorite. Gnits are exceedingly optional at the moment as their main purpose is feeding Lura plants, but you can easily use Mimikas as a native option, Shine bugs or Beetas (which are free like Gnits). With how optional Gnits are, a phosphorite source would give them a unique role, but still not a particularly critical one for players who don't want to bother with Gnits.

This would also be compatible with how Dreckos make Phosphorite for free by eating resourceless Balm Lily, and Bammoths are part of a resource positive loop that also produces phosphorite out of thin air.
